40 package edu.rit.mp.buf;
41
42 import java.nio.ByteBuffer;
43
44 import edu.rit.mp.Buf;
45 import edu.rit.mp.DoubleBuf;
46 import edu.rit.pj.reduction.DoubleOp;
47 import edu.rit.pj.reduction.Op;
48
49 /**
50 * Class DoubleItemBuf provides a buffer for a single double item sent or
51 * received using the Message Protocol (MP). While an instance of class
52 * DoubleItemBuf may be constructed directly, normally you will use a factory
53 * method in class {@linkplain edu.rit.mp.DoubleBuf DoubleBuf}. See that class
54 * for further information.
55 *
56 * @author Alan Kaminsky
57 * @version 25-Oct-2007
58 */
59 public class DoubleItemBuf
60 extends DoubleBuf {
61
62 // Exported data members.
63 /**
64 * Double item to be sent or received.
65 */
66 public double item;
67
68 // Exported constructors.
69 /**
70 * Construct a new double item buffer.
71 */
72 public DoubleItemBuf() {
73 super(1);
74 }
75
76 /**
77 * Construct a new double item buffer with the given initial value.
78 *
79 * @param item Initial value of the {@link #item} field.
80 */
81 public DoubleItemBuf(double item) {
82 super(1);
83 this.item = item;
84 }
85
86 // Exported operations.
87 /**
88 * {@inheritDoc}
89 *
90 * Obtain the given item from this buffer.
91 * <P>
92 * The <code>get()</code> method must not block the calling thread; if it does,
93 * all message I/O in MP will be blocked.
94 */
95 public double get(int i) {
96 return this.item;
97 }
98
99 /**
100 * {@inheritDoc}
101 *
102 * Store the given item in this buffer.
103 * <P>
104 * The <code>put()</code> method must not block the calling thread; if it does,
105 * all message I/O in MP will be blocked.
106 */
107 public void put(int i,
108 double item) {
109 this.item = item;
110 }
111
112 /**
113 * {@inheritDoc}
114 *
115 * Create a buffer for performing parallel reduction using the given binary
116 * operation. The results of the reduction are placed into this buffer.
117 * @exception ClassCastException (unchecked exception) Thrown if this
118 * buffer's element data type and the given binary operation's argument data
119 * type are not the same.
120 */
121 public Buf getReductionBuf(Op op) {
122 return new DoubleItemReductionBuf(this, (DoubleOp) op);
123 }
124
125 // Hidden operations.
126 /**
127 * {@inheritDoc}
128 *
129 * Send as many items as possible from this buffer to the given byte buffer.
130 * <P>
131 * The <code>sendItems()</code> method must not block the calling thread; if it
132 * does, all message I/O in MP will be blocked.
133 */
134 protected int sendItems(int i,
135 ByteBuffer buffer) {
136 if (buffer.remaining() >= 8) {
137 buffer.putDouble(this.item);
138 return 1;
139 } else {
140 return 0;
141 }
142 }
143
144 /**
145 * {@inheritDoc}
146 *
147 * Receive as many items as possible from the given byte buffer to this
148 * buffer.
149 * <P>
150 * The <code>receiveItems()</code> method must not block the calling thread; if
151 * it does, all message I/O in MP will be blocked.
152 */
153 protected int receiveItems(int i,
154 int num,
155 ByteBuffer buffer) {
156 if (num >= 1 && buffer.remaining() >= 8) {
157 this.item = buffer.getDouble();
158 return 1;
159 } else {
160 return 0;
161 }
162 }
163
164 }
